Marten, mink, fisher, squirrels, wolverines, coyotes, wolves, were and are hunted or trapped for their furs. None were for food.

The Burke family in this picture is holding up their pelts that are ready for sale.

Fur was sold at the Old Hudson Bay Company at the 0ld Fort, or to a fur buyer. If fur was not worth very much it was used for trim or clothing.
